I Spy With My Little Eye …
In one game in 2007, it was found that a New England video assistant filmed the hand signals of the opponents in an unauthorized location. A week later, the Patriots owned up to the mistake and the head coach Bill Belichick was slapped with a $500K-fine and the team with $250K.
Called the “Spygate,” Belichick explained that while he had knowledge of the deed, he had no idea that it was against the NFL rules. Quite strange, right? Analysts couldn’t help but feel that the coach should have been sacked.
